Sugar spheres are used in the formation of pellets which are then used in oral medication. Sugar spheres are white seeds made up of sucrose and starch. Sugar spheres are produced by using a layered sugar-coating structure. Sugar spheres are also known as neutral pellets, nonpareil seeds, microgranules, or sugar beads. The ultimately finished pellet has no active substances, which makes it useful for low-dose substances or substances that have a high effect/dose relation.

Sugar spheres are highly useful in the making of combination drugs. Its spherical shape comes from its flowability when used in bulk. Apart from its use in oral medication, it is also used in edible food products. They have the advantage of high mechanical stability and no friability. It also has the excellent microbiological quality and controlled particle size distribution. Sugar spheres offer no attrition and a smooth, non-porous surface.

LATEST TRENDS

Sustained-Release Tablets to Boost Growth

A new application of sugar spheres has come up recently, which is used in sustained-release tablets. Sustained-release tablets are released more slowly in the bloodstream in comparison to other tablets. It maintains a constant level of medication all over the body, without any area receiving more or less. Fewer doses of sustained-release tablets are required in comparison to other medications. This reduces the expenditure of the patients and makes it more feasible for them to carry out the entire treatment regimen. Side-effects associated with sustained-release tablets are much fewer, which makes them more attractive to both doctors and patients. It decreases the potential toxicity of the drug components and improves the plasma levels in the body of the injected. The sugar spheres market growth is going to be positively augmented due to the use of sustained-release tablets.

  • According to the U.S. Pharmacopeia (USP) pharmaceutical excipient standards, alternative inert core materials such as microcrystalline cellulose pellets and non-pareil seeds are increasingly used in drug formulation. Microcrystalline cellulose-based pellets can provide mechanical strength improvements of nearly 15–20% compared with traditional sugar cores. The growing availability of these alternatives can reduce reliance on sugar spheres in some pharmaceutical pelletization applications.
  • According to the European Directorate for the Quality of Medicines (EDQM), pharmaceutical pellet cores must maintain particle size deviation limits below ±10% to ensure consistent drug coating and dosage accuracy. Sugar sphere production involves multiple steps such as layering, drying, and polishing, which require strict process control. Manufacturing defects can increase batch rejection rates by nearly 5–8% in pellet production facilities, creating operational challenges for manufacturers.
